Denmark 5-1 Kazakhstan Denmark move further clear at the top of Group 2 with a dazzling display.

By Peter Bruun
Denmark's Under-21 national team have moved five points clear at the top of Group 2 after a convincing win against Kazakhstan at Brøndby stadium in front of 1,200 spectators.
Agger double
It took the Danish team just three minutes to go ahead through central defender Daniel Agger, and Leon Andreasen doubled their lead 40 minutes later. The visitors pulled one back courtesy of Sergey Skorykh on the stroke of half-time, before Denmark resumed control with second-half strikes from Michael Krohn-Dehli, Morten Nicolas Rasmussen and Agger, finishing off what he had started with his second and Denmark's fifth.

Denmark visit Ukraine, who dropped to third following Turkey's win today, on Tuesday hoping to further stretch their lead and all but seal their place in November's play-offs, while Kazakhstan will have to wait until June for their next match, also away in Ukraine.
